Yuga
American
[yoog-uh]
/ ˈyʊg ə /
noun
Hinduism.
-
an age of time.
-
any of four ages, the Satya, the Treta, the Dvapara, and the Kali, each worse than the last, forming a cycle due to begin again when the Kali has come to an end.
